Carlsbad-Artesia Market Summary

Carlsbad-Artesia, NM is experiencing a correction with -2.5% year-over-year decline, signaling a buyer's market with softening demand. Affordability remains favorable with a price-to-income ratio of 2.88x, below the national average of 4.8x. Modest net positive migration (+1 returns/year) provides steady demand support. Climate risk is moderate (50/100) with manageable exposure. Rental yield of 9.11% is strong, making this market attractive for buy-and-hold investors.
